Tarves scores 37/100 overall, across 7 scored categories. Its biggest lead over the typical UK town is bills: 77/100 against a national town median of 47/100. The biggest shortfall against other towns is broadband: 11/100 versus a median of 60/100.

Among the 5 scored places sharing the AB41 postcode district, Tarves ranks 3rd. That is 13 points below the national benchmark of 50, the bottom quarter of all UK towns and villages. Crime is scored from the last 12 months of police street-level data. Police Scotland does not publish this, and there is no Scottish equivalent of the Police UK open data service, so crime has been left out of the score for this area. This is a gap in published data, not a sign of low crime.

Sold-price data isn't available for Tarves. HM Land Registry's Price Paid dataset covers England and Wales only. Scottish sales are recorded separately by Registers of Scotland, which we don't yet include. This is a gap in the data we hold, not a sign of an inactive market.
